About J. Ross
J. Ross is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Genetics, Pathology and Forensic Medicine, Neurology and Urology, having authored 6 papers that have together received 99 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Traumatic Brain Injury and Neurovascular Disturbances (1 paper), Osteoarthritis Treatment and Mechanisms (1 paper), NF-κB Signaling Pathways (1 paper), Immunotherapy and Immune Responses (1 paper), Corneal Surgery and Treatments (1 paper), Neurosurgical Procedures and Complications (1 paper), Dermatological and Skeletal Disorders (1 paper) and R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Dermatology (20 citations), Genetics (23 citations), Urology (10 citations), Immunology (31 citations) and Rheumatology (18 citations). J. Ross has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om and Netherlands. Frequent co-authors include Peter S. Friedmann, G.P. Ford, Brian Diffey, Debby Gawlitta, Lizette Utomo, Alessia Longoni, P Bird, I. S. Grant, P. R. Coburn and Robin Sellar. Their work appears in journals such as British Journal of Dermatology, European Cells and Materials, Journal of Clinical Neuroscience, PubMed and European Journal of Echocardiography.
